Output 3a84c06a75f9080f56fe7280f24424ea9dbbdd5c27e5abbc706730b8bf16d0f6:18

value
99710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af594d4c83e7acbb1ac4cb28c46e1f6d0a9bec55 OP_EQUAL
address
3HgB9vSitN4qjTtgWgmi1TuoqAenNohaL1
transaction
3a84c06a75f9080f56fe7280f24424ea9dbbdd5c27e5abbc706730b8bf16d0f6
confirmations
63524
spent
true